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
Привет Какая-то хрень. На одном и том же IQueryable<MyClass> вызываю FirstOrDefault() - всё ок, а LastOrDefault() валится: Выражению LINQ to Entities не удается распознать метод "MyClass LastOrDefault[Position](System.Linq.IQueryable`1[MyClass], System.Linq.Expressions.Expression`1[System.Func`2[MyClass,System.Boolean]])", поэтому его нельзя преобразовать в выражение хранилища. Из-за чего может быть? Запрос, таблица и набор данных идентичны для обоих вызовов: Код: c# 1. 2. 3.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 16:27 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ortis, Linq преобразуется в sql. Какой sql должен быть во случае LastOrDefault?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 16:42 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
А зачем? Метод всё равно не заработает 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 16:46 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
Это LINQ to Entities, похоже он не поддерживает Last(). Придётся куролесить 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 16:53 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ortis, Код: c# 1. 2. 3.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 17:47 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ortisПридётся куролесить а что мешает получить первую запись в обратной сортировке? религия? понимаю, что LINQ это блэкбокс, но не до такой же степени. хоть грамм понимания что, зачем и для чего делаешь, должен же быть??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.07.2014, 18:05 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ortisА зачем? Метод всё равно не заработает Они не должен работать, в sql нет понятия "последней" записи. Первой кстати тоже нет, но First преобразуется в Select top 1 .... order by <все поля> если не указана сортировка.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 13.07.2014, 02:52 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
hVosttrigorMortisПридётся куролесить а что мешает получить первую запись в обратной сортировке? религия? понимаю, что LINQ это блэкбокс, но не до такой же степени. хоть грамм понимания что, зачем и для чего делаешь, должен же быть?? А каша в голове должна быть? Если и должна то не надо здесь её вываливать, прожуйте сначала.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.07.2014, 02:34 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ortisА каша в голове должна быть? Если и должна то не надо здесь её вываливать, прожуйте сначала. лучше иди с мальчишками в футбол поиграй, дитятко.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.07.2014, 03:03 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
hVosttrigorMortisА каша в голове должна быть? Если и должна то не надо здесь её вываливать, прожуйте сначала. лучше иди с мальчишками в футбол поиграй, дитятко. С тобой то есть.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 14.07.2014, 23:25 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
rigorMortis а вот хамство со стороны человека который не знает как использовать инструменты выглядит как то печально и уныло 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.07.2014, 09:23 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
off: всем привет :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.07.2014, 09:32 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
МСУ, ОО откинулся :)) Бан - это молча сидеть у реки и наблюдать как тихо проплывают труппы твоих оппонентов ( как то так по конфуцию)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.07.2014, 10:42 |
|
||
|
ASP.NET MVC LINQ: не работает LastOrDefault().
|
|||
|---|---|---|---|
|
#18+
Где-то в степитихо проплывают труппытруппы? это это-то новенькое в конфуцианстве )))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 15.07.2014, 10:52 |
|
||
|
|

start [/forum/topic.php?fid=18&msg=38696647&tid=1357146]: |
0ms |
get settings: |
9ms |
get forum list: |
16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
34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
48ms |
get tp. blocked users: |
1ms |
| others: | 227ms |
| total: | 356ms |

| 0 / 0 |
